Project Partners

Working together to improve transit in the Twin Cities region

The Metropolitan Council is the lead agency developing the METRO Blue Line Extension Project. Many public and private partners are working together with the Council to make this project a reality by contributing funding, oversight and expertise.

The Federal Transit Administration

The Federal Transit Administration (FTA) is part of the U.S. Department of Transportation and provides capital funding grants for rail transit improvement projects through the New Starts program.

Hennepin County

Hennepin County and the Hennepin County Regional Railroad Authority provide funding for the project. The County's Bottineau LRT Community Works program is involved in land use planning around light rail stations.

The Counties Transit Improvement Board

The Counties Transit Improvement Board (CTIB) provided project funding until its dissolution in 2017.
